Sarpsborg Roklubb and the Norwegian Rowing Federation host the Open Baltic Cup 2024

Sarpsborg Roklub, in collaboration with the Norwegian Rowing Federation, is proudly hosting the annual Baltic Cup this weekend at the scenic Tunevannet lake in Sarpsborg. This prestigious event welcomes junior rowers under the age of 18 from ten nations, offering a platform for young athletes to showcase their skills and passion for rowing on an international stage.

Competing nations include Denmark, Estonia, Finland, Germany, Latvia, Lithuania, Norway, Poland, Sweden, and this year also Ukraine. Close to two hundred rowers will battle it out over two days, racing the Olympic-standard distance of 2000 meters on Saturday, followed by a fast-paced 500-meter sprint on Sunday. The competition is a key milestone for many young athletes on the path to becoming international competitors.

These aspiring rowers will be representing Norwegian Rowing this weekend: 

  • W1X // Ylva Dahl (CR) and Mimmi Skjold Hansen (Fana)
  • M1X // Benjamin Haug Hagen (CR)
  • W2X // Cornelia Riis,Thea Barski (Bærum) and Sara Harris (Tønsberg), Hannah Ossenkamp (Drammen)
  • M2X // Henrik Høeg, Cornelius Varden Økern (CR)
  • M2- // Oscar Myran, Luca Trentani (Fana) and Håkon Mjelde, Bastian Halvorsen (Bergens)
  • W4X // Rakel Bryhni, Hedda Hjemdal, Marit Henden, Ann Yasuda (CR)
  • M4X // Andreas Tol, Andreas Follnes, Isak Larson, Daniel Kjærnet (Bergens)
  • W4- // Julia Hanken, Mia Sæter-Hoel, Maria Wiik, Oline Hanken (Aalesunds)
  • M4- // Mads Høeg, Martin Anker, Jasper Viksås, Eskil Heiberg (NSR)
